Bought this scanner to replace my failed Epson Perfection 1650. I like its compact size and quietness, and find the operating speed close to that of the 1650. The software is ok, and scanner operation is as convenient as that of the 1650, but there is less flexibility to allow altering color satuation, hue, etc. I found image sharpness disappointingly soft, and color saturation less than that of the original photo being copied. The overall effect is a somewhat faded, hazy image. Tried downloading and installing a fresh driver, but that didn't change this characteristic. After selecting USE SCANNER DRIVER on the operating panel, I was able to make selections that improved the image quality somewhat, but it is still not up to the performance of my previous scanner. Turning off the softening mask makes very little improvement. For me this scanner does not live up to previous glowing user reviews that helped decide this purchase.

I needed a scanner to scan an occasional document, receipt, or magazine page. Image quality needed to be decent and other than that I wanted a device that just did the job and didn't need a lot of hand-holding.

So far I'm satisfied to impressed. Take it out of the box, plug in the USB cable (big plus it doesn't add yet another power adapter to my setup), Windows Vista automatically detects and installs the driver and you're ready to go. I didn't even look at the software CD which comes with the scanner for the first week. The OS integrated driver is sufficient for the generic scans.

It's nice and small and lightweight, has a small locking slider for the lid on the bottom. So when I'm not scanning I simply unplug the USB port and it's easily stored on the shelf and not taking up valuable space.

The scan speed and image quality is good enough for my needs. I'm sure some folks may have a more detailed critique, but that wasn't what I'm looking for.

After eventually installing the software that came with it, the copy button on the front works fine. Push it and the software will scan and then send the result to the printer. Not a high volume copying solution, but if one makes a copy at home once in a blue moon and hates the trip to Kinko's this fits in well.

So if you're looking for a simple and reasonably priced scanning solution for occasional work, this is a great choice.

Pros: very easy to setup. buttons on front work as advertised, as long as the software is installed. Nice image quality from scans. VERY LOW power consumption (i think it consumes 2 full watts when scanning). No External power supply needed.

Cons: 24 second scanning is a little much for this day and time. I know it is a higher resolution, but still. A full scan should take less than 10 seconds in 2009. Other than this, it would be five star.

Overall: For a general use scanner, I really doubt you could beat this one. It is inexpensive, compact, does the job well, and uses very little energy. What more could you ask for?

---
One Year Update - the scanner is still functioning great. After using it for a year, I will say that the MP Navigator software is not that special, and could be a little easier to use for the average home user. I have recently just been using Acrobat Std. to import scanned documents as PDFs as it is quicker and will a pretty good job @ OCR. Still four out of five stars.

In the past, I've been very critical of Canon's incredibly lame support for providing updated drivers for the Macintosh. As such, I was really hesitant about buying another Canon scanner. But, I was assured that this scanner would work seamlessly with the Image Capture application in Mac OS X (10.6, Snow Leopard), without having to install any drivers whatsoever. So I tried it.

And it works just fine. I unboxed the scanner, plugged the USB cable from it to my Mac, and launched Image Capture. The scanner showed up and I was able to start scanning. No software install required at all. Thank goodness!

For a Mac user, this scanner seems like a very safe bet. Hope this helps.
